Rangers striker Alfredo Morelos has claimed that Celtic midfielder Scott Brown “exaggerated” the contact that saw him sent off.

The Ibrox hothead picked up an incredible FIFTH red card of the season on Sunday. It was, incredibly, just his first against Celtic. Three of them came against Aberdeen, however, showing how much he struggles to cope with discipline in big games.

Despite that, however, he has pointed a finger of blame over to the Celtic captain. Instead of taking full responsibility for his own actions, he decided to say that the Celtic squad put pressure on the officials to give the decision.

Alfredo Morelos believes the Celtic players got him sent off (Ian MacNicol/Getty Images)

Speaking to Colombian outlet Blu Radio, Morelos couldn’t help but aim a dig at the Celtic players.

“I always come into contact with the Celtic captain and I’ve always had strong contact with him and its always been like that. I didn’t touch his face and I think that he exaggerated a lot.

“Neither the referee nor his assistant saw what happened. Celtic players went over and put pressure on the linesman and then not even five seconds later the linesman told the referee to send me off.

“Like I said, I have to confront these things in the best way possible and that’s what I’m doing. I apologised publicly and well, we have to keep moving forward, with my head held high.”
